How to Convert Fathom to Mile

1 fathom = 0.00113636 miles

Mile = Fathom × 0.00113636

Example: 3510 ftm × 0.00113636 = 3.9886 mi

Reverse Conversion

To convert miles back to fathoms:

  • Remember, 1 mile equals 880 fathoms.
  • To convert 3.9886 mi to ftm, multiply 3.9886 x 880, resulting in 3510 ftm.

About these units

Fathom: Maritime unit equal to six feet, traditionally used for measuring water depth.

Mile: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 5,280 feet, standard for road distances in US/UK.
